This TEN DAY unit, 43 pages in length, however you can use as little or as much as you like. It is suitable for middle and high school drama classes and includes:

  • Teacher's Note
  • Lesson on the history of radio theater
  • Information about Foley engineers
  • Three links to video clips of Foleys
  • Student created sound effect project
  • Five links to radio play performances (some vintage and some recent)
  • Lesson in writing and producing radio commercials
  • Links to four commercials and two acting exercises focused on sound effects
  • Procedure plan to follow throughout the unit (including minutes allotment)
  • Teacher’s script--what I say and how I say it!
  • Sound effects quiz and teacher's key--just for the fun of it!
  • Radio theater terms--to help the novice director
  • Student group example of a radio commercial
  • Trivia about radio theater star-- Betty White!
  • Trivia concerning Little Orphan Annie and the Radio Drama Program of England
  • Page demonstrating how to direct a radio play
  • Floor plan for blocking and an explanation of the floor plan
  • Page advising what certain stage directions mean which are specific to radio
    play
  • Radio Theater terms--what the heck does "walla walla" mean?
